Though the adventure ended prematurely, the results achieved by François Duval - Patrick Pivato and the Skoda Fabia WRC « First » shows everybody that Willy Collignon and his Skoda Import and Kizz-Me partners have brilliantly taken up the challenge.
Duval-Pivato had ranked 6th on Friday at the end of the Rallye de Monte-Carlo’s first leg - opening round of the 2006 World Rally Championship -, Saturday they had moved up a position in the overall standings after the first two stages, moving to 5th overall
« We were heading for the podium », explained Duval, who had tried to win back the minutes lost on Friday morning after a wrong tyre choice. « But, of course, to achieve such good times, we had to attack. In stage 9, we got to a skid braking, I used the handbrake to put the car in the right direction… but it ended slightly below the road, resting on its crankcase protection. And while we were vainly trying to get the car out of there, the reverse broke. »
« The Monte-Carlo Rally is a real specific event and is not representative of the rallyes to come. We could have ended the race and started again in the super rallye. However, in agreement with all parties, we decided to concentrate our efforts on preparing for the next Rally – with more tests », said Willy Collignon, showing much confidence for the next WRC events : « Our team and car proved their competitiveness. The future will surely be full of good surprises ! ».
